Sri Lanka's inexperienced cricket team overcame a poor start with bat and ball to put on an impressive all-around show Sunday and win the Asia Cup for the sixth time with a 23-run victory over Pakistan.

Bhanuka Rajapaksa hit an unbeaten 71 off 45 balls in Dubai and led Sri Lanka as it recovered from 58-5 to reach 170-6 in the final after Pakistan won the toss and elected to field.

Hasaranga, who earlier scored 36 off 21 balls, had Pakistan's top-scorer Mohammad Rizwan caught in the deep in his last over before claiming the wickets of Asif Ali and Khushdil Shah in the same over to finish with 3-27. Madushan, who made his T20 debut in the last Super 4 match against Pakistan on Friday, settled his team's nerves quickly by claiming the wickets of Babar Azam and Fakhar Azam off successive deliveries inside the power play.

Madushan broke the stand in his return spell as Pakistan collapsed from 102-3 to lose its last seven wickets for 45 runs with Sri Lanka fielders holding onto all their catches.
